Your Opportunity

In line with Group policies and local (labour) law, the HR Manager is responsible for the day-to-day operations of the site from the HR perspective. Together with the site leader and the local management team, he/she will embrace our goal of sustainable engagement of our workforce: engaged, enabled and energized. He/she also carries an HR Business Partner role to engage together with the entire HR Americas community (Canada, Mexico, Brazil, Chile) their site(s) in the transformation journey needed from the business and the society evolution. He/she will also lead or participate to global HR projects to support the overall group HR strategy. The HR Manager reports to the VP HR Americas based in Norcross and supervise the local Pay-roll Expert.

Your Mission

  • Group Policy & procedures: implement HR policies, procedures and processes and drive the related change management.
  • Mexico Local policies & procedure: Ensure all local policies and procedures are up to date and in line with current employment law (Employee Handbook etc.). Ensure line managers understand the policies and are up to date with any changes.
  • Career growth and Succession planning: support talent management programs and succession planning
  • Learning & Development: Ensure proper guidance on development for managers and their teams and support implementation of defined development plans
  • Training: Implement the training and development agenda, identify areas that need attention and improvement.
  • Performance Management: Coach Managers on performance management culture, principles and processes.
  • Compensation & Benefit/Payroll: Lead the salary process locally. Supervise payroll (or perform as back up of the payroll expert). Review Benefit competitiveness through benchmark, coordinate and implement changes if necessary.
  • Employee Administration: ensure proper absence, disciplinaries, grievances, sickness and other cases management as needed.
  • Employee Engagement: Follow EE Survey process, identify areas for improvement, coordinate action plans and follow-up
